The Role:
Your role encompasses various responsibilities aimed at delivering exceptional service and maintaining operational efficiency. You will be the primary point of contact for customers, handling telephone inquiries, addressing their needs, and resolving any issues they encounter. Additionally, you will prepare hire quotes for both new and existing clients, ensuring accuracy in rental pricing data. Collaboration with our depot network is essential for coordinating plant allocation and scheduling logistics, while maintaining compliance with company procedures when processing customer purchase orders. Proactively chasing outstanding quotes and promptly reporting findings to the appropriate manager is crucial for streamlining operations. Your duties also include generating rental-related paperwork, such as Job Sheets, Delivery and Off Hire Notes, to facilitate smooth transactions. Furthermore, you will uphold the company's ISO 9001:2015 Quality and ISO 14001 Environmental procedures, actively contributing to our continuous improvement program.
